2022-11-30 13:07来源:m.sf1369.com作者:宇宇
Excel跨工作簿引用数据的具体操作步骤如下:
1、我们可以把目标文件存储在单元格,选择性粘贴,粘贴链接,就可以实现Excel跨工作簿引用数据了。
2、我们还可以在excel 目标文件存储单元格输入公式来实现Excel跨工作簿引用数据,首先我们选中excel表格里一个单元格。
3、然后我们直接在单元格里输入VLOOKUP函数,后面直接点击要引用的单元格就行。
4、我们打开两个Excel文件,在a文件的某单元格中输入VLOOKUP后,再点另一文件的某工作表中的B15,然后回车,结果就出来了。
5、对于EXCEL的查找函数是用来查找数据表中相关的数据,使用这个函数的前提就是要有共同的ID索引,通过以上步骤我们即可实现Excel跨工作簿引用数据的操作。
1,首先打开要处理数据的多个工作簿。,选择“平均分”工作表,把光标定位在B3单元格中。在B3单元格中输入公式符号“=”。
2,把光标移动到任务栏中Excel程序图标上,此时会弹出打开的所有工作簿。单击其中要引用的工作簿“1班成绩表”。此时会切换到“1班成绩表“工作簿中,单击此工作簿中的D9单元格,也就是”语文“成绩的平均分。
3,然后再单击公式编辑栏中的“√”输入按钮。程序会自动跳转到“平均分”工作簿中。且把“1班成绩表”中的数据引用到了此工作簿中。
①相同工作簿不同工作表间相互引用,在引用单元格前加Sheetn!(Sheetn为被引用工作表的名称)
举例:如工作表Sheet1中的A1单元格内容等于Sheet2中单元格B2乘以5,则在Sheet1中的A1单元格中输入公式 =Sheet1!B2*5
②不同工作簿间互相引用,在引用单元格前加[Book.xlsx]Sheet!(Book为被引用工作薄名,Sheet为被引用工作表名)
举例:如工作薄”Book1“中Sheet1中的A1单元格内容等于工作薄”Book2“Sheet1中单元格B2乘以5,则在Sheet1中的A1单元格中输入公式 =[Book2.xlsx]Sheet1!$B$2*5
要弄懂公式,首先要明白通配符的含义:通配符问号?可以匹配任何单个字符。 通配符星号*可以匹配任意个任意字符Excel中引用本工作簿的单元格一般是这样的
='6月'!H12
可以看出,公式=SUM('*'!B2)
中的星号*所在的位置就是表格名称。因而,可以得出,公式=SUM('*'!B2)也就是对本工作簿中所有“工作表名称符合条件”的工作表(不含本工作表)的B2单元格进行求和由于星号*可以匹配任意个任意字符,所以肯定是所有表格都符合条件,至于为什么没有包含公式所在工作表,这应该是Excel设计时特意这样安排的。 接下来,我们拓展延伸一下如果公式改成:=SUM('??'!B2)
就是对工作表名称为二个字符的表格的B2单元格进行求和。如果公式改成:=SUM('???'!B2)
就是对工作表名称为三个字符的表格的B2单元格进行求和。需要注意的是:由于公式所在工作表的在工作簿的位置不同,输入带通配符的同一公式,最终得到的公式也会不同。比如说明:汇总表的位置不同,最终得到的公式不同,这是因为要将公式所在的表格剔除。最后,感谢购买《“偷懒”的技术:打造财务Excel达人》,欢迎加入读者群166053131,学习过程中有疑问请在群里留言。
Excel要想引用另一个表格里的数据,我们可以先把另一个表格里面的数据需要引用的部分全部复制粘贴到这个表格当中,然后再把这些数据放在当前这个Excel表当中的相应的位置,这样操作就可以了,就可以完成,把另一个表格里面的数据引用到当前的工作表当中。
有两个原因,第一个原因是你公式本身就写错了,b2应该引用工作表中的b2,或者在本工作簿中的b2中增加“男”字。第二个原因是sumif是个半残废,在跨工作簿时,被引用的工作簿必须时打开状态,如果仅打开带有sumif的工作簿,就会返回错误值,这个是微软的锅,谁知道微软这个奇葩是怎么设计的。另外还有好多函数都是这个样子,千万不要掉坑里了。所以最好不要跨工作簿使用sumif等带有缺陷的函数。
Excel要想引用另一张表的数据,我们可以先把这个要拉到最底下,然后在空白区域内,我们将另一张表的数据全部复制粘贴到这个表的空白区域,然后在需要的地方我们就把底下的数据复制粘贴过去,但是在复制粘贴的状态下,我们一定要保证复制粘贴所有的单元格式,诠释以单元格的形式存在,不要有合并单元格的这种形式的存在就可以。
独立的excel文档叫做工作簿。跨簿引用要加路径,双簿打开时,点下被引用工作簿的单元格,路径就过来了,然后改一下,关闭以后会显示全路径,例如=VLOOKUP(A2,'D:\Users\Administrator\Desktop\[234.xlsx]Sheet2'!$A:$B,2,0)
同时打开要引用多个工作簿的工作表。
在要显示结果的工作表中输入:=分别点击要引用的工作表标签再点击要引用的单元格。
多个工作簿中的单元格要用需要运算的运算符连接(=+,-,*,/)
材料/数据:excel2010
1、打开一个excel2010工作薄例如:在此工作薄中有两个工作表,一个是“2018年”,另一个是“2017年”。
2、选择“2018年”工作表,单击C3单元格,在此单元格中输入公式符号“=”。
3、现在要引用“2017年“工作表中的数据,所以用鼠标单击“2017年”这个工作表的标签。
4、然后在”2017年“工作表中单击要引用的数据所在的单元格。这里要引用的数据为B3单元格。
5、单击B3单元格后,在公式编辑栏中的公式为:“='2017年'!B3”,表示引用2017年工作表中B3单元格中的数据。
6、单击公式编辑栏中的“输入”按钮以确认输入的公式生效。
7、公式生效后返回到“2018年”工作中,其中C3单元格中的数据就是引用的“2017年”工作表中的数据。
不是无法引用,而是无法使用鼠标指向法输入单元格引用,原因是两个Excel工作簿在不同的进程,打开任务管理器可以看到有两个Excel进程。因此输入=号,再用鼠标单击另一工作簿的单元格,无法自动输入引用地址。
产生原因:都是双击Excel文件图标打开的文件。解决方法:打开一个文件后,通过“文件”>>>“打开”命令,打开另一个文件。